The Evolution of IgE-Based Allergy Testing in Atopic Dermatitis: Where Do We Stand?

Atopic dermatitis (AD) management requires careful consideration of allergies. While food allergens can trigger AD, IgE allergy testing is often unreliable; maintaining oral food exposure is key to preventing food allergies.
Area of Science:
- Immunology
- Dermatology
- Allergy
Background:
- Atopic dermatitis (AD) pathophysiology involves skin inflammation, primarily driven by innate immunity and T cells, with Immunoglobulin E (IgE) having a minor role in most cases.
- A defective skin barrier in AD patients increases susceptibility to environmental antigens and heightens the risk of developing food allergies.
- The role of IgE-mediated allergy testing in AD patients remains a subject of debate due to the complexity of the condition.
Purpose of the Study:
- To clarify the relevance of IgE-mediated allergy testing in atopic dermatitis (AD) patients.
- To emphasize the importance of oral food exposure for preventing food allergies in atopic individuals.
- To guide clinical practice regarding food allergen management in AD.
Main Methods:
- Review of existing literature on atopic dermatitis pathophysiology and allergy testing.
- Analysis of the diagnostic value of skin prick tests and specific IgE measurements in AD patients.
- Evaluation of the impact of dietary antigen exposure on food allergy development.
Main Results:
- IgE plays a limited role in the majority of AD cases, making IgE-mediated allergy testing less predictive.
- High IgE levels in AD patients can lead to a low positive predictive value for skin prick tests and specific IgE tests.
- Oral exposure to foods is crucial for preventing or delaying the onset of food allergies in atopic individuals.
Conclusions:
- IgE allergy testing in AD should be reserved for cases with immediate hypersensitivity reactions like urticaria or angioedema, not eczema.
- Maintaining dietary foods is vital to prevent the development of IgE-mediated food allergies, despite potential contributions to AD.
- The primary goal in managing AD patients with food concerns should be to control the condition while ensuring continued dietary exposure to potential allergens.

Antibody Structure
Antibodies, also known as immunoglobulins (Ig), are essential players of the adaptive immune system. These antigen-binding proteins are produced by B cells and make up 20 percent of the total blood plasma by weight. In mammals, antibodies fall into five different classes, which each elicits a different biological response upon antigen binding.
